We’ve devoted many an episode to the ups and downs of affiliate marketing. Usually, we’re discussing the merits and drawbacks of affiliate marketing for those wondering whether they should get into it.But today, we’ve got a question from a listener who’s already in the affiliate game, and wants to know one thing: whether it’s time to move on. Is affiliate marketing something you “graduate” from before launching your own product? If so, how do you know when it’s time?Affiliate marketing is often sold as easy income — all you have to do is promote someone else’s product, and let the commissions roll in. Easy, right? But experience tells us that affiliate marketing is much more involved, and not nearly as passive as people think. So it’s no small decision to choose whether to invest more fully into it, or to debut your own product.Today, we discuss how you can simultaneously affiliate market while promoting your own product.
